Early Voting in IOWA

In person - Any qualified voter may vote early in person at his County Auditor’s Office as soon as ballots are ready.  Contact information for County Auditor's Offices is available at www.sos.state.ia.us/elections/auditors/auditor.asp?CountyID=00

By mail - A qualified voter may vote early by mail. The voter must submit an Absentee Ballot Request Form to his County Auditor’s Office no later than the Friday before the election.  The Absentee Ballot Request form is available online at www.sos.state.ia.us/elections/AbsenteeBallot/index.html.  All vote by mail ballots must be postmarked no later than the Monday before the election.
